Sidi Cadi Haja
Sidi Cadi Haja is a tomb in El Jadida Province, Casablanca-Settat. Sidi Cadi Haja is situated nearby to the village Oulad Hcine.Places in the Area

Oulad Hcine
Village
Oulad Hcine is a small town and rural commune in El Jadida Province of the Casablanca-Settat region of Morocco. At the time of the 2004 census, the commune had a total population of 27,475 people living in 4626 households. Oulad Hcine is situated 4½ km northwest of Sidi Cadi Haja.
